I was blessed to get a week and a half of vacation in one of my favorite places in this world: Virginia's Blue Ridge.
Along with general rest and a lot of family time, I was able to get out and do a little bit of fishing. In this week's episode I talk through why this region is special, how I spent my time on the water, and some tactics that you might find useful.
